    Will be going back to Disney in the summer of 2017 will be staying back on Disney property, question are the Disney hotels less expensive during a weekday stay or a weekend stay

    Hi Renee!

    In my experience, there is actually no day of the week that is consistently less expensive. Among the things that could possibly determine the price of Resort rooms are the time of year you are visiting, special events that are being held on property and availability, among others. My advice would be to click on the Places to Stay tab on the Walt Disney World website, enter dates, check the cost, and repeat the process with different dates to compare the two prices. You could also visit the Special Offers page to see if there are discounts available to you during the time you want to visit.
